What is the ICD 10 code for gastric bypass surgery?

Bariatric surgery status ICD-9-CM V45.86 is a billable medical code that can be used to indicate a diagnosis on a reimbursement claim, however, V45.86 should only be used for claims with a date of service on or before September 30, 2015. For claims with a date of service on or after October 1, 2015, use an equivalent ICD-10-CM code (or codes).

How do you code gastric bypass surgery?

Open gastric bypass (CPT code 43846) involves both a restrictive and a malabsorptive component, with the horizontal or vertical partition of the stomach performed in association with a Roux-en-Y procedure (ie, a gastrojejunal anastomosis). Thus, the flow of food bypasses the duodenum and proximal small bowel.Mar 15, 2020

What is the ICD 9 code for bariatric surgery?

ICD-9-CM V45. 86 converts directly to: 2022 ICD-10-CM Z98. 84 Bariatric surgery status.

What is procedure code 43644?

43644- Laparoscopy, surgical, gastric restrictive procedure; with gastric bypass and Roux-en-Y gastroenterostomy (roux limb 150 cm or less). 43645-Laparoscopy with gastric bypass and small intestine reconstruction to limit absorption.Apr 28, 2006

Is gastric bypass the same as bariatric surgery?

Overview. Gastric bypass and other weight-loss surgeries — known collectively as bariatric surgery — involve making changes to your digestive system to help you lose weight. Bariatric surgery is done when diet and exercise haven't worked or when you have serious health problems because of your weight.Sep 18, 2021
